超全OpenClaw(龙虾)for API testing合集
2026-03-19 2引言
超全OpenClaw(龙虾)for API testing合集 是面向开发者与技术型跨境运营人员的开源API测试工具资源集合,非商业SaaS产品,也非平台官方服务。OpenClaw(中文圈俗称“龙虾”)是GitHub上一个轻量级、命令行驱动的API自动化测试框架,专为高频调用跨境电商平台(如Amazon SP-API、Shopify Admin API、Walmart Marketplace API等)设计。

要点速读(TL;DR)
- ✅ 开源免费:MIT协议,无订阅费、无调用量限制;
- ✅ 聚焦跨境API:预置主流平台认证模板、错误码映射、重试/限流策略;
- ✅ 适合技术自建能力中等以上的团队:需基础Shell/Python/JSON知识,不提供可视化界面;
- ⚠️ 非即插即用:需自行配置环境、编写测试用例、集成CI/CD;
- 🔍 不替代Postman或Swagger UI,但更适合批量回归验证与上线前冒烟测试。
它能解决哪些问题
- 场景痛点1:SP-API Token频繁过期或Refresh失败 → 价值:内置OAuth2.0自动续期逻辑+失败日志分级归因(如403 vs 401);
- 场景痛点2:多站点(US/CA/DE/JP)API响应结构微差异导致解析报错 → 价值:提供站点维度Schema校验模板与字段兼容性比对脚本;
- 场景痛点3:大促前需快速验证库存同步、订单抓取、发货回传链路 → 价值:支持YAML定义测试序列,一键执行端到端流程断言(含状态码+关键字段+耗时阈值)。
怎么用/怎么开通/怎么选择
OpenClaw无“开通”概念,属本地部署工具。常见接入流程如下(以Amazon SP-API为例):
- Step 1:确认运行环境——Linux/macOS + Python 3.9+ + pip;
- Step 2:克隆仓库:
git clone https://github.com/openclaw/openclaw.git(注意核对Star数≥350、Last commit ≤3个月); - Step 3:安装依赖:
cd openclaw && pip install -r requirements.txt; - Step 4:配置凭证——将LWA Client ID/Client Secret、Role ARN、Seller ID等填入
config.yaml,密钥建议通过环境变量注入; - Step 5:编写测试用例——参考
examples/spapi_inventory_test.yaml格式,定义endpoint、method、headers、expected_status、jsonpath断言; - Step 6:执行测试:
python main.py -c config.yaml -t examples/spapi_inventory_test.yaml,输出含HTTP trace与断言结果。
注:不同平台API需对应调整认证方式(如Shopify用Private App Token,Walmart用JWT),具体以各平台官方文档及OpenClaw Wiki为准。
费用/成本通常受哪些因素影响
- 开发人力成本:熟悉YAML语法、API鉴权机制、JSONPath表达式所需学习时间;
- 维护成本:平台API升级(如SP-API v2023-12-01变更InventoryV0字段)需同步更新测试用例与Schema;
- 基础设施成本:若集成至Jenkins/GitLab CI,涉及服务器资源或云构建分钟数消耗;
- 安全审计成本:因需存储LWA密钥等敏感信息,企业级使用需额外配置Secret Manager或Vault方案;
- 故障排查成本:无官方技术支持,依赖GitHub Issues社区响应(平均响应时长≈48小时,据2024年Q2卖家实测)。
为了拿到准确实施成本,你通常需要准备:目标平台清单+API调用频次(TPS)、现有CI/CD架构图、团队Python/YAML熟练度评估表。
常见坑与避坑清单
- ❌ 坑1:直接在
config.yaml硬编码密钥 → 避坑:改用export LWA_CLIENT_SECRET="xxx"+ 在YAML中引用${LWA_CLIENT_SECRET}; - ❌ 坑2:忽略平台Rate Limit Header(如
x-amzn-RateLimit-Limit)→ 避坑:在测试用例中添加wait_after_call: 0.5或启用内置throttling插件; - ❌ 坑3:用
$.payload断言所有响应,未适配SP-API部分接口返回payload为空对象 → 避坑:优先使用jsonpath_ng语法写容错断言,如$..sku ? (@.length > 0); - ❌ 坑4:将OpenClaw误当监控工具长期运行 → 避坑:它无告警推送、无历史趋势图表,仅适合定时任务触发的离线验证,生产环境监控请另选Prometheus+Blackbox Exporter方案。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w是开源项目(GitHub仓库可查),代码透明、无后门、无数据上传行为(所有测试均在本地执行)。其合规性取决于使用者——只要API调用符合平台《Developer Policy》(如SP-API要求每小时不超过1500次调用),工具本身不构成违规。但不得用于绕过平台风控规则或批量爬取非授权数据。
{关键词} 适合哪些卖家/平台/地区/类目?
适合具备基础开发能力的中大型跨境卖家、ERP厂商、独立站技术团队,尤其适用于:多平台运营(Amazon+Shopify+Walmart组合)、高SKU自营品牌、有API灰度发布需求的团队。不推荐纯铺货型小微卖家或零技术背景运营人员直接使用。
{关键词} 怎么开通/注册/接入/购买?需要哪些资料?
无需开通/注册/购买。只需:GitHub账号(用于fork/watch)、目标平台开发者资格(如Amazon Seller Central中已获批SP-API权限)、终端设备(Mac/Linux)、基础命令行操作能力。无企业资质、营业执照、法人信息等要求。
结尾
超全OpenClaw(龙虾)for API testing合集是技术自驱型团队提效利器,但需匹配相应工程能力。

